Transaction 5bf15004000d09622cb6bd829f2458e7f025d3a99e64449a47a8ece3417e4ad0
1 Input
1 Output
-
5bf15004000d09622cb6bd829f2458e7f025d3a99e64449a47a8ece3417e4ad0:0
- value
- 30767334
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 37b280f405ac4c4103d8e1d6d2f289a179c4eebb OP_EQUAL
- address
- 36mWvkVAQiM3pLvptWGaTV33iGYaZCQEMu